AFCON U-20 Qualifiers (1st Round, 1st Leg):

  • Saturday, March 31, 2018 (Kick-off: 4 pm)
  • Uganda Hippos Vs South Sudan
  • At Star Times Stadium, Lugogo (Kampala)

Uganda national U-20 head coach, Mathias ‘Salongo’ Lule has named an all attack minded team to face South Sudan in the first leg of the CAF U-20 qualifier slated at Lugogo this Saturday.

Proline experienced goalkeeper Saidi Keni starts in between the goal posts ahead of Express and Buddo S.S’ Tonny Kyamera.

Police’s Paul Willa and KCCA’s Mustapha Kizza take the right and left back roles respectively.

The center defensive partnership of Geofrey Wasswa (Vipers) and the team vice captain, Musitafa Mujjuzi (Proline) is maintained just like they played at the 2017 COSAFA U-20 championship in Zambia.

Express anchorman Abubakar Kasule starts in the defensive midfield position.

Kasule will be surrounded by a string of proven, tried and tested ball players in team captain Julius Poloto (KCCA), Frank ‘Zaga’ Tumwesigye (Vipers), Allan Okello (KCCA) and Joshua Okiror (Proline).

These will be tasked to feed the robust and pacy lone center forward, Steven Dese Mukwala of Vipers Sports Club.

Waiting list:

On the substitutes’ bench, it remains another rich list comprising of Tonny Kyamera (goalkeeper), Hamis Tibita (striker), promising Buddo S.S play maker Sadam Masereka, URA right back Fred Okot, among others.

The match kicks off at 4 pm and will be handled by FIFA referees from Rwanda.

The return leg comes between April 17th and 20th in Juba, with the successful country advancing to the next round to face Cameroon in a two legged encounter for a slot to the 2018 AFCON U-20 finals in Equatorial Guinea.

Uganda Hippos XI Vs South Sudan:

Keni Saidi (Proline), Paul Willa (Police), Mustapha Kizza (KCCA), Musitafa Mujjuzi (Proline), Geofrey Wasswa (Vipers), Abubaker Kasule (Express), Julius Poloto (Captain, KCCA), Frank “Zaga” Tumwesigye (Vipers), Joshua Okiror (Proline), Steven Dese Mukwala (Vipers), Allan Okello (KCCA)

Match Officials:

  • Center Referee: Adel Adam Mukhtar (Sudan)
  • Assistant Referee 1: Ahmed Elnour Haitham (Sudan)
  • Assistant Referee 2: Ahmed Mohamed Omer Hamid (Sudan)
  • Fourth Official: Mutaz Abdelbasit Abdelbasit Khairalla (Sudan)
  • Commissioner: Gaspard Kayijuka (Rwanda)
